Life in G51 1PL is enriched by a range of amenities within walking or short transit distance. Retail options include Co-op Ibrox, Morrisons Daily Glasgow, and Aldi Helen, providing everyday shopping needs. The area’s transport links connect residents to Glasgow’s vibrant cultural scene, including the Kelvingrove Art Gallery and the city’s historic architecture. Parks like Glasgow Green offer green space for relaxation, while the Forth and Clyde Canal adds a scenic element to leisure activities. Nearby, Dunard Primary School serves the local community, and the postcode’s proximity to the city’s commercial and educational centres ensures a dynamic lifestyle. How reliable is the internet and mobile coverage in G51 1PL?
The area has a broadband score of 100 — the highest possible — ensuring excellent home internet connectivity. Mobile coverage scores at 85 indicate good signal strength, though not perfect, for everyday use and communication.
